This book explores the thesis that contemporary conflicts in the Middle East region, including the extremely low standard of living, cause two main crises - terrorism and migration, which are the result of the outlined foreign policy strategies of the United States of America and their conceptual understanding that outside their territory they can pursue policies to guarantee their own national security by supporting governments with a pro-Western orientation, and to overthrow inconvenient regimes through the use of military force, while proclaiming at the same time democratic values and the fight against international terrorism. Military and civil conflicts in the Middle East create serious challenges for their resolution by Arab and European countries, including the Bulgarian state.
